Long-tail Keywords
Long-Tail Keywords
They aren't long keywords or key phrases, but when you look at a graph of your search hits from most searched for terms to least searched for terms the smaller ones you'll find a Long-Tail in the graph.
If you develop a strategy to attack keywords that people are looking for you can become an authority on greater search terms
If a post gets two search hits per month and you have a 1000 blog posts you now have 2,000 extra hits per month.
Eventually the pages that get a few hits in total bring in more traffic than your main couple of pages
Consistent addition of content
Websites are not brochures or posters
Many sites sit and don't change
Search engines will rank you lower if you site stays stagnate for long periods of time
A blogging strategy allows your site to stay fresh and current
Consistent writing can create consistent readers
Many consistent readers can create a community.
Consistent readers count you as an authority.
Consistent readers will share your content.
